ORA-23384: 複製並行推送 string 參數超出範圍 ORACLE 報錯 故障修復 遠程處理
在使用 Oracle 數據庫的過程中,開發者和數據庫管理員可能會遇到各種錯誤代碼,其中之一便是 ORA-23384。這個錯誤通常與複製和並行推送操作有關,並且會顯示出「複製並行推送 string 參數超出範圍」的提示。本文將深入探討這個錯誤的成因、影響以及修復方法。
ORA-23384 錯誤的成因
當 Oracle 數據庫在執行複製操作時,可能會因為以下幾個原因導致 ORA-23384 錯誤:
- 參數設置不當:在進行複製時,某些參數的設置可能超出了允許的範圍。例如,並行推送的數量或大小可能設置得過高。
- 資源限制:系統資源(如內存或 CPU)不足,無法支持當前的複製操作。
- 版本不兼容:使用的 Oracle 數據庫版本可能不支持某些複製功能,導致錯誤發生。
錯誤的影響
當 ORA-23384 錯誤發生時,將會影響到數據的複製過程,可能導致數據不一致或丟失。此外,這也會影響到應用程序的正常運行,進而影響業務的連續性。因此,及時修復這個錯誤是非常重要的。
故障修復步驟
修復 ORA-23384 錯誤的過程可以分為以下幾個步驟:
1. 檢查參數設置
首先,檢查複製操作中使用的所有參數。確保所有參數的值都在允許的範圍內。可以使用以下 SQL 查詢來檢查當前的參數設置:
SELECT * FROM v$parameter WHERE name LIKE '%parallel%';2. 調整資源配置
如果發現系統資源不足,可以考慮增加內存或 CPU 的配置。這可以通過調整數據庫的初始化參數來實現。
3. 更新 Oracle 版本
如果使用的 Oracle 版本不支持某些功能,建議考慮升級到最新版本。這不僅可以解決當前的錯誤,還能提高系統的穩定性和性能。
4. 監控和日誌檢查
檢查 Oracle 的日誌文件,尋找與 ORA-23384 錯誤相關的其他信息。這可以幫助確定問題的根本原因。
遠程處理的考量
在某些情況下,數據庫管理員可能無法直接訪問數據庫進行故障排除。此時,可以考慮使用遠程處理工具來協助解決問題。確保使用的工具能夠安全地連接到數據庫,並具備必要的權限來執行故障排除操作。
總結
在 Oracle 數據庫中,ORA-23384 錯誤可能會對數據複製過程造成影響,及時識別和修復這一錯誤至關重要。通過檢查參數設置、調整資源配置、更新 Oracle 版本以及進行日誌檢查,可以有效地解決此問題。若需進一步的技術支持或解決方案,考慮使用 香港VPS 服務,以確保您的數據庫環境穩定運行。